亚洲香蕉成人av网站在线观看_欧美精品成人91久久久久久久_久久久久久久久久久亚洲_热久久视久久精品18亚洲精品_国产精自产拍久久久久久_亚洲色图国产精品_91精品国产网站_中文字幕欧美日韩精品_国产精品久久久久久亚洲调教_国产精品久久一区_性夜试看影院91社区_97在线观看视频国产_68精品久久久久久欧美_欧美精品在线观看_国产精品一区二区久久精品_欧美老女人bb

首頁 > 服務器 > Web服務器 > 正文

docker官方mysql鏡像自定義配置詳解

2024-09-01 13:55:59
字體:
來源:轉載
供稿:網友

之前為了節省安裝時間,所以用官方mysql docker鏡像啟動mysql。

通過

 

復制代碼代碼如下:
$ docker run --name some-mysql -e MYSQL_ROOT_PASSWORD=my-secret-pw -d daocloud.io/mysql:tag

 

some-mysql 指定了該容器的名字,my-secret-pw 指定了 root 用戶的密碼,tag 參數指定了你想要的 MySQL 版本

這樣數據是沒有持久化的 所以在啟動參數中需要掛載本地目錄

于是這樣數據庫一直跑著,但是由于最近程序需要支持emoji表情,不得不將mysql的字符集更改。

 

復制代碼代碼如下:
$ docker run --name some-mysql -v /my/own/datadir:/var/lib/mysql -e MYSQL_ROOT_PASSWORD=my-secret-pw -d daocloud.io/mysql:tag

 

這時候就可以掛載自定義配置文件,官方文檔說明

當 MySQL 服務啟動時會以 /etc/mysql/my.cnf 為配置文件,本文件會導入 /etc/mysql/conf.d 目錄中所有以 .cnf 為后綴的文件。這些文件會拓展或覆蓋 /etc/mysql/my.cnf 文件中的配置。因此你可以創建你自己需要的配置文件并掛載至 MySQL 容器中的 /etc/mysql/conf.d 目錄。

所以最簡單改變數據庫配置的方式就是在宿主機上新建配置文件,改成utf8mb4

[client]default-character-set=utf8mb4[mysqld]character-set-client-handshake = FALSEcharacter-set-server = utf8mb4collation-server = utf8mb4_unicode_ci[mysql]default-character-set=utf8mb4

隨后將文件復制到相應docker容器文件夾下

docker cp /home/my.cnf(宿主機文件路徑) [容器id]:/etc/mysql/mysql.conf.d

最后使用docker stop和start命令重啟容器就實現了加載自定義配置。

由Docker的MySQL官方鏡像配置的容器無法啟動問題

我使用的是MySQL的Docker鏡像。先創建并啟動鏡像:

# docker run --name mysql-b /> -p 33002:3306 -v /zc/mysql/datadir-b:/var/lib/mysql /> -e MYSQL_ROOT_PASSWORD='123456' -d mysql:latest

正常啟動,沒有問題。通常我們使用MySQL的時候,需要設置參數。要設置參數,我們先得進入容器的bash,進行操作:

docker exec -it mysql-b bash

MySQL的默認配置文件是 /etc/mysql/my.cnf 文件。如果想要自定義配置,建議向 /etc/mysql/conf.d 目錄中創建 .cnf 文件。新建的文件可以任意起名,只要保證后綴名是 cnf 即可。新建的文件中的配置項可以覆蓋 /etc/mysql/my.cnf 中的配置項。因為 MySQL 的 Docker 官方鏡像沒有提供 vim 編輯器,所以我用cat命令生成文件并添加內容:

# cat >test.cnf <<EOF[mysqldump]user=rootpassword='123456'[mysqld]max_allowed_packet=8Mlower_case_table_names=1character_set_server=utf8max_connections=900max_connect_errors=600default-character-set=utf8EOF

退出后,停止容器,再重新啟動容器,發現容器無法啟動。

解決方法

刪除原來那個不能啟動的容器。重新創建一個新的容器。問題的關鍵在于原來的 test.cnf 文件有錯誤。找到原來配置文件的最后一行:

default-character-set=utf8

把這一行刪除。添加配置文件的時候保證沒有這一行就可以了。

問題原因

MySQL 的官方 Docker 鏡像里面,在標簽 latest 下,[mysqld] 這一配置段上并沒有 default-character-set 這一配置項。 
如果你要查看所有的配置項,可以使用如下命令,利用管道將輸出的幫助都放到 help.txt 文件里面:

docker run -it --rm mysql:tag --verbose --help > help.txt

其中 tag 表示鏡像的標簽,比如 latest 和 5.6。

以上就是本文的全部內容,希望對大家的學習有所幫助,也希望大家多多支持VEVB武林網。


注:相關教程知識閱讀請移步到服務器教程頻道。
發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
亚洲香蕉成人av网站在线观看_欧美精品成人91久久久久久久_久久久久久久久久久亚洲_热久久视久久精品18亚洲精品_国产精自产拍久久久久久_亚洲色图国产精品_91精品国产网站_中文字幕欧美日韩精品_国产精品久久久久久亚洲调教_国产精品久久一区_性夜试看影院91社区_97在线观看视频国产_68精品久久久久久欧美_欧美精品在线观看_国产精品一区二区久久精品_欧美老女人bb
国产精品稀缺呦系列在线| 亚洲2020天天堂在线观看| 九九热99久久久国产盗摄| 国产成人精品一区二区三区| 在线观看精品国产视频| 最近2019中文字幕在线高清| 亚洲无限乱码一二三四麻| 日本国产一区二区三区| 国产精品永久在线| 国语自产精品视频在线看抢先版图片| 18性欧美xxxⅹ性满足| 欧美亚洲另类激情另类| 亚洲午夜精品久久久久久性色| 久久91超碰青草是什么| 国产精品视频26uuu| 色综合久久88| 国产精品v日韩精品| 国产精品久久久久久久久| 91精品中文在线| 国产在线视频不卡| 欧美在线视频导航| 国产亚洲精品久久久久动| 91久久久亚洲精品| 亚洲女人初尝黑人巨大| 国产欧美va欧美va香蕉在线| 欧美激情亚洲另类| 高跟丝袜一区二区三区| 亚洲在线www| 91久久在线视频| 久久影院在线观看| 欧美极品少妇xxxxⅹ裸体艺术| 欧美插天视频在线播放| 亚洲欧美另类中文字幕| 久久久久成人网| 黑人巨大精品欧美一区免费视频| 性欧美xxxx视频在线观看| 国产精品视频公开费视频| 日韩av免费看网站| 精品无人区太爽高潮在线播放| www国产亚洲精品久久网站| 亚洲精品免费在线视频| 欧美男插女视频| 国产精品自产拍高潮在线观看| 国产a级全部精品| 不卡伊人av在线播放| 久久久亚洲国产| 日韩av在线网页| 欧日韩不卡在线视频| 国模吧一区二区三区| 91日本在线视频| 亚洲综合中文字幕在线| zzjj国产精品一区二区| 精品人伦一区二区三区蜜桃网站| 日韩av片免费在线观看| 国产精品色悠悠| 亚洲第一福利网| 久久伊人精品视频| 国产suv精品一区二区| 亚洲免费小视频| 91精品啪aⅴ在线观看国产| 国产精品丝袜白浆摸在线| 成人网在线免费观看| 亚洲国内高清视频| 亚洲第一区在线观看| 久久精品中文字幕| 国产激情综合五月久久| 国产日韩欧美影视| 久久夜色精品国产欧美乱| 91国在线精品国内播放| 欧美电影免费观看网站| 日韩视频欧美视频| 日韩亚洲欧美中文高清在线| 精品日本美女福利在线观看| 亚洲日本中文字幕| 久久精品91久久久久久再现| 国产精品入口福利| 日韩三级影视基地| 国产欧美亚洲精品| 久久精品国产69国产精品亚洲| 国产小视频国产精品| 精品国产户外野外| 日韩一区二区欧美| 亚洲少妇激情视频| 国产精品视频xxxx| 日韩av片免费在线观看| 日韩精品亚洲精品| 欧美国产日韩中文字幕在线| 国产一区二区三区三区在线观看| 日韩精品中文字幕在线| 欧美精品九九久久| 成人激情视频网| 亚洲精品美女在线| 欧美激情精品久久久久久| 在线视频欧美日韩精品| 亚洲国产高清福利视频| 亚洲一区精品电影| 在线视频欧美日韩| 国产一区二区欧美日韩| 亚洲毛片在线免费观看| 成人av在线天堂| 欧美性猛交xxxx免费看久久久| 俺也去精品视频在线观看| 国产精品久久久久久一区二区| 日韩精品在线第一页| 亚洲黄色www网站| 中文欧美日本在线资源| 91精品国产自产91精品| 欧美色欧美亚洲高清在线视频| 欧美一级片久久久久久久| 国产福利精品av综合导导航| 久久国产精品久久久久久| 久久这里只有精品视频首页| 亚洲天天在线日亚洲洲精| 92裸体在线视频网站| 亚洲精品一区二区在线| 欧美高清视频一区二区| 久久夜精品香蕉| 亚洲国产高潮在线观看| 日韩欧美综合在线视频| 黄色一区二区三区| 成人免费淫片视频软件| 日本高清不卡在线| 欧美亚洲日本网站| 2018中文字幕一区二区三区| 日韩在线视频观看正片免费网站| 国产97在线|日韩| 国产精品久久久久久亚洲影视| 国产日韩中文在线| 色妞欧美日韩在线| 欧美日韩国产一区二区三区| 91在线观看欧美日韩| 亚洲精品日韩欧美| 黄网站色欧美视频| 97av视频在线| 精品香蕉在线观看视频一| 国产精品一区二区三区久久久| 亚洲欧美激情精品一区二区| 日韩高清av在线| 国产在线98福利播放视频| 欧美国产第二页| 亚洲日韩第一页| 欧美亚洲在线播放| 久久久久亚洲精品成人网小说| 中文字幕日韩高清| 97超碰国产精品女人人人爽| 欧美视频一区二区三区…| 欧美激情综合色| 欧美大人香蕉在线| 精品国产31久久久久久| 欧美丝袜一区二区三区| 日韩精品www| 国产精品极品尤物在线观看| 九九热精品在线| 91视频-88av| 欧美精品生活片| 国产精品1区2区在线观看| 亚洲变态欧美另类捆绑| 久久精品国产v日韩v亚洲| 精品国产精品自拍| 日韩av在线免费播放| 欧美精品成人在线| 午夜欧美不卡精品aaaaa| 国产精品网站视频| 国产精品成人av在线|